About the editors
Prof. RenpengChen is a Professor of Geotechnical Engineering at Hunan University. He works as the Dean of the college of civil engineering at Hunan University. His research interests and expertise includes characterization of pavement and railroad geomaterials, i.e., subgrade soils and foundation soils, soft soil improvement using piles, offshore pile foundation, and TBM tunneling technologies. He has published over 100 peer-reviewed papers about his research projects. Prof. Chen is the associate editor-in-chief of China Journal of Highway and Transport, and the editorial board member of 5 Journals. He is a member of Committee of Sustainability in Geotechnical Engineering (TC307), Asian Regional Technical Committee of Urban Geotechnics, of International Society of Soil Mechanics and Geotechnical Engineering, and vice chair of 3 technical committees of Soft Soil Engineering, Soil Constitutive Relationship and Strength Theory, Transportation Geotechnics, of Chinese Institute of Soil Mechanics and Geotechnical Engineering. Prof. Chen received Best Paper Awards of 2013ISEV, 2015 Outstanding Journal Paper Awards of Journal of Performance of Constructed Facilities-ASCE, China Youth Science and Technology Award (200 persons every two years in China). He also received National Science Fund for Distinguished Young Scholars, and was elected as the Leading Researcher of Ten Thousand Talent Program in China (2016).
Prof. Gang Zheng is a Professor at Department of Civil Engineering at Tianjin University. He is the Dean of School of Civil Engineering at Tianjin University. He is the vice president of the Chinese Institution of Soil Mechanics and Geotechnical Engineering (CISMGE), the member of TC204, ISSMGE (Technical Committee of Underground Construction in Soft Ground) Prof. Zheng’s research and practical experiences are mainly focused on deep excavation, ground improvement, pile foundations, and shield tunneling. Prof. Zheng has co-authored one technical book, edited one ASCE Geotechnical Special Publications, and published more than 210 peer-reviewed journal papers and about 30 conference papers. Prof. Zheng works as a member of the editorial boards for three major national journals in civil and geotechnical engineering and one international journal. Prof. Zheng received the 2013 R.M. Quigley Award by the Canadian Geotechnical Society for the best paper in the Canadian Geotechnical Journal in 2012. He also received the Award of Young Geotechnical Expert of Mao Yisheng Soil Mechanics and Geotechnical Engineering in 2010. He has won the second prize of National Scientific and Technological Progress Award in China, the first prize of Scientific and Technological Progress Award of Ministry of Education and the second prize of Scientific and Technological Progress Award of Tianjin Municipal Government.
